Coxos seasonal overview
Coxos in Portugal is a powerful, reef-bottomed right-hand point break that thrives on consistent ground swells and favorable offshore winds. The best months for surfing here are from October through March, when ground swell dominates (66-91% of the time) and swell heights average 2.1-2.7 meters, providing the size and power this wave is known for. Winter months, particularly December to February, offer the biggest and cleanest conditions, though wind conditions are less ideal (only 31-33% good wind days). However, the sheer quality of the swell compensates for the occasional onshore winds. Spring (April-May) and summer (June-August) see a significant drop in ground swell activity, replaced by weaker wind swells and smaller waves (1.5-1.8m). Wind conditions also worsen during this period, with only 20-24% favorable winds. September and October mark the transition back to better surf, with ground swell returning and wind conditions improving slightly. Late autumn through early winter (November-December) is ideal for surfers who prioritize consistency and size, while those willing to trade power for slightly more manageable conditions might find October or March a good compromise. Overall, Coxos is a winter spot, with the most reliable waves and highest performance conditions occurring when the North Atlantic storms generate strong ground swells.

Conditions at Coxos in January
January at Coxos delivers solid surf conditions, with an average swell height of 2.7m and a strong 12.9s period, indicating powerful, well-formed waves. The dominant swell direction is from the W to WNW, contributing the majority of waves in the 1.5–2.5m+ range, offering consistent, high-quality rides. Offshore winds (ideal for surfing) occur 32% of the time, most frequently from the E to NE, helping to groom the waves. However, strong onshore winds from the W to NW can disrupt conditions, particularly at higher speeds (20–50kph). Expect a mix of clean sessions and windy days, with the best windows when offshore winds align with the dominant W/WNW swell. Intermediate to advanced surfers will find the most success, as the size and power demand experience.
